During the operation of an ultrasound test, very high-frequency sound waves are built to pass through your body by an instrument known as a transducer. The transducer can be responsible for reflecting the data connected with digestive orders on to the screen in the computer.

Ultrasound Delhi creates an image from the soft tissue organs and abdominal structures like the kidneys, liver, gall bladder, pancreas, stomach and the like. The ultrasound image can be capable of detecting blockages in the arteries-if any. Ultrasound imaging is affordable, safe to complete and produces accurate results.

Digestive Problems Diagnosed by an Ultrasound

Diagnostics hospital in Alaska conduct ultrasound tests to detect various digestive disorders and problems.These are:

An abnormal enlarging with the spleen
Abnormal growths or cysts in the pancreas, intestines, spleen, kidney or liver
Fatty liver or cancerous growth inside the liver
Sludge or stones within the gall bladder as well as a host of other digestive conditions.
How safe is Ultrasound?

Patients experiencing digestive orders usually undergo ultrasound tests that do not portray any potential side effects or gloomy effects. In addition, these tests do not include any discomforting measures of diagnosis or radiations as found in X ray Alaska. Generally, ultrasounds don't require any elaborate preliminary preparations, though some patients could possibly be asked to stay well hydrated or fast for several hours before their tests.
